Transaction 320581ebe61b2aedfaa07afa86b48ab3bf8c13d89f3306ae4b1c8c27f23f86d8
1 Input
1 Output
-
320581ebe61b2aedfaa07afa86b48ab3bf8c13d89f3306ae4b1c8c27f23f86d8:0
- value
- 62528
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 53dae5027f53f47c815f472cb51ab443eb047ab9 OP_EQUAL
- address
- 39LQEXX3ns7tuz6dfBXvm1KPNuTgK7y6RR